我们需要将月份减1,可以使用Calendar.MONTH常量表示月份,使用负数表示减去月份。代码示例如下: calendar.add(Calendar.MONTH,-1); 1. 5. 获取计算后的时间 经过步骤4的操作,Calendar对象的时间已经减去了一个月。如果需要获取计算后的时间,可以使用getTime()方法来获得一个Date对象。代码示例如下: DatenewDate=calend...
Date类有一个默认的构造方法,可以创建一个表示当前时间的Date对象。 Datenow=newDate();System.out.println(now); 1. 2. 上述代码会打印当前的日期和时间,例如:Sun Sep 26 15:19:06 CST 2021。 减一个月的操作 要对日期进行减一个月的操作,我们可以使用Calendar类。Calendar是一个抽象类,提供了处理日期的...
@文心快码BaiduComatejava date减少一个月 文心快码BaiduComate 在Java中,减少一个Date对象所表示的月份,可以通过Calendar类来实现。以下是详细的步骤和代码示例: 创建一个Java Date对象表示当前日期: java Date currentDate = new Date(); 使用Calendar类来操作这个Date对象: java Calendar calendar = Calendar....
java操作时间,将当前时间减一年,减一天,减一个月 在Java中操作时间的时候,常常遇到求一段时间内的某些值,或者计算一段时间之间的天数 Date date =new Date();//获取当前时间 Calendar calendar = Calendar.getInstance(); calendar.setTime(date); calendar.add(Calendar.YEAR, -1);//当前时间减去一年,即一年...
可以使用Calendar类来实现当前时间减去一个月的操作,具体步骤如下: // 获取当前时间 Calendar cal = Calendar.getInstance(); // 减去一个月 cal.add(Calendar.MONTH, -1); // 获取减去一个月后的时间 Date oneMonthAgo = cal.getTime(); // 打印结果 SimpleDateFormat sdf = new SimpleDateFormat("yyyy...
Java获 取时间,将当前时间减一年,减一天,减一个月 在Java中操作时间的时候,需要计算某段时间开始到结束的区间日期,常用的时间工具 Date date = new Date();//获取当前时间 Calendar calendar = Calendar.getInstance(); //创建Calendar 的实例 calendar.add(Calendar.YEAR, -1);//当前时间减去一年,即一年前的...
Java获取时间,将当前时间减一年,减一天,减一个月 在Java中操作时间的时候,需要计算某段时间开始到结束的区间日期,常用的时间工具 Date date = new Date();//获取当前时间 Calendar calendar = Calendar.getInstance(); //创建Calendar 的实例 calendar.add(Calendar.YEAR, -1);//当前时间减去一年,即一年前的...
如何从当前日期减少一个月并想在 java.util.Date 变量im 使用此代码但它在第二行显示错误 java.util.Date da = new Date(); da.add(Calendar.MONTH, -1); //error 如何将此日期存储在 java.util.Date 变量中? 原文由 karthi 发布,翻译遵循 CC BY-SA 4.0 许可协议 java...
如何从当前日期减少一个月并想在 java.util.Date 变量im 使用此代码但它在第二行显示错误 java.util.Date da = new Date(); da.add(Calendar.MONTH, -1); //error 如何将此日期存储在 java.util.Date 变量中? 原文由 karthi 发布,翻译遵循 CC BY-SA 4.0 许可协议 java...
2、String转换成Date后格式化成自定义时间格式的String类型 一、普遍例子 1、代码 void contextLoads() { Date date = new Date();//获取当前时间 System.out.println(date); SimpleDateFormat simpleDateFormat =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");//设置格式 ...